Brick & Block Interlock And Landscape Logo

Brick & Block Interlock And Landscape

Brick & Block Interlock And Landscape Design

Scroll down to learn more about Brick & Block Interlock And Landscape services

Brick & Block Interlock And Landscape

Brick & Block Interlock And Landscape Design

Brick & Block Interlock And Landscape logo image

Author Profile: nbland


Full Name:

Author has no posts.
